Two bedroom one bath mobile home with new paint, ceramic flooring and blinds on a private secured lot. Has outdoor storage, covered patio and parking. This is a non- smoking home with a one year lease. Rent is $950 with a $950 deposit. Applicants must have a stable work history ( check stubs will be required). To view the the property and to submit an application please reply. Located in Central La.

Renter pays all utilities except water.
